At least 10 foreign terrorists were neutralized during a joint Mianwali Operation carried out by the Counter-Terrorism Department (CTD) and local police. The clash took place in the Makarwal area of Mianwali, according to police sources.
During the intense exchange of gunfire, a civilian was also hit. The victim suffered a gunshot wound to the leg. He was quickly shifted to a nearby hospital for medical care.
The Mianwali Operation is still ongoing. Security forces continue to confront the remaining militants hiding in the area. Authorities have confirmed that all CTD and police personnel involved in the Mianwali Operation are safe and have not suffered any injuries.
Sources added that several more terrorists were wounded during the firefight. The law enforcement teams are carefully advancing to secure the region completely.
